#43d610 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43d610 is composed of 26.3% red, 83.9%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 104.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 45.1%. #43d610 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ff20 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#43d610 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43d610 has RGB values of R:67, G:214,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4445712.

Shades and Tints of #43d610
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#43d610
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727571 is the less saturated color, while #3fdf07 is the most saturated one.
